Output 1fbf3ca63a22c9aa779ebe4d67893116a0b6fac66f737e6f810ef92c59841806:0

value
1684066
script pubkey
OP_0 OP_PUSHBYTES_20 cbaf3deb13e51ae2e99a82c740a07ffd77dfc609
address
bc1qewhnm6cnu5dw96v6str5pgrll4mal3sf3efv4g
transaction
1fbf3ca63a22c9aa779ebe4d67893116a0b6fac66f737e6f810ef92c59841806
spent
true